“Well, Mr. Marcus Jackson, about the sachet…” The assistant hesitated.
Marcus raised an eyebrow and thought for a moment. “Do as she says. Take it away for now.”
It wasn’t that he actually believed Anastasia’s explanation—he just wanted to prove her wrong with the facts. He was eager to see what excuse she’d come up with when the truth was laid out in front of her.
The weekend passed in a blur, and Monday arrived before anyone realized it.
That morning, while Anastasia was getting ready for class, Harrison was also busy packing things.
Something about it didn’t sit right with Marcus.
“Harrison, where are you going?” he asked suspiciously.
Harrison glanced at him, his expression as calm as ever. “Ana has to go back for her classes. Rosewood Manor’s too far from campus, it’s inconvenient to go back and forth. So we’re moving back to the apartment near the university.”
“Wait, she’s going to school—so why are you going, too?”
Harrison paused, glancing over, his face unreadable. “Why are you asking so many questions?”
At that moment, Anastasia came running over, hands on her hips. “I can’t be away from my hubby! Of course he’s coming with me. Is there a problem?”
Marcus was stunned.
Was this really the Harrison he knew?
His newlywed wife couldn’t bear to be apart from him, so he just dropped everything and moved near campus to keep her company? If only Marcus knew the truth: it was Harrison who couldn’t stand being away from her. That revelation might make his jaw hit the floor.
As the realization sank in, Marcus was struck by another thought—if both of them left, wouldn’t Rosewood Manor be empty, leaving him alone in that massive house?
“I’m coming, too!” he blurted out.
Anastasia and Harrison turned to look at him, equally unimpressed.
Anastasia asked flatly, “And what exactly are you going to do there?”
Harrison added, “There’s no room for you.”
